Word info Synonyms

Democratic Front for the Liberation of Palestine

Noun

Meaning

a Marxist-Leninist group that believes Palestinian goals can only be achieved by revolutionary change

Source: WordNet

Synonyms

Examples

in 1974 the DFLP took over a schoolhouse and massacred Israeli schoolchildren Source: Internet

Close letter words and terms